The Bowers Parent-Teacher Association has<br />

sponsored family nights for each grade level this<br />

school year. Students, along with their families and<br />

teachers have enjoyed theme-based nights ranging<br />

from Dr. Seuss, Winter Wonderland, Family Game<br />

Night and most recently, Family Fitness Nights.<br />

The Family Fitness Nights for grades four and five<br />

involved family members trying out some of the<br />

physical fitness tasks which students are tested on in<br />

the Connecticut Physical Fitness Assessment.<br />

Bennet Academy<br />

On Friday, March 2, 2012, Bennet Academy held<br />

its fourth annual CMT Kick-<br />

Off and Pep Rally. Students<br />

were entertained and<br />

motivated by this special<br />

CMT Rally held in the<br />

gymnasium. The purpose of<br />

the rally was to promote<br />

enthusiasm and reinforce<br />

good preparation habits for<br />

positive performance on the<br />

Connecticut Mastery Tests which are held during<br />

the month of March. Hosted by our own<br />

“Superman,” aka Principal David Welch, the event<br />

included appearances by the Bennet Singers,<br />

Dance Troupe Two By Two, and the Bennet<br />

Recreation Cheerleaders. As additional<br />

Illing Middle School<br />

On Wednesday, April 18 th , there will be a Lasagna<br />

Dinner and Book Fair at Illing Middle School from<br />

4:30 - 7:00 p.m. Cost is $8.00 per person and<br />

includes cheese lasagna, salad, garlic bread, dessert<br />

and a drink. This is the fourth year this supper has<br />

been organized to raise funds needed for the<br />

Washington, D.C. Scholarship Fund. The Illing<br />

community is trying to raise $10,000 to help<br />

families challenged<br />

with economic<br />

hardship, so their<br />

children can attend this<br />

worthwhile trip.<br />

Students are required to<br />

complete community service to receive these funds<br />

and we often have many Student Council members<br />

assist us. In addition, the Book Fair provides the<br />

opportunity for families and the public to purchase<br />

books and media materials.<br />
